ISO/TR 14179-2:2001 provides a technical framework for calculating and measuring the thermal load-carrying capacity of gear units, covering both load-dependent and no-load power losses in various gear types. It establishes methods for determining thermal balance through heat dissipation via housing, radiation, and external coolers, serving as a guideline for operating gearboxes within safe temperature limits.
